首页>>帮助中心>>量子化学计算美国VPS环境配置

量子化学计算美国VPS环境配置

2025/5/31 26次
量子化学计算美国VPS环境配置 量子化学计算作为计算化学的前沿领域,对计算资源有着极高的要求。本文将详细解析如何在美国VPS环境中配置量子化学计算平台,涵盖软件选择、系统优化、并行计算设置等关键环节,帮助科研人员突破本地计算资源限制,实现高效能的远程量子化学模拟。

量子化学计算美国VPS环境配置-高性能计算解决方案

量子化学计算对VPS的特殊需求分析

量子化学计算(Quantum Chemical Calculations)因其复杂的算法特性,对计算环境有着严苛的要求。在美国VPS(Virtual Private Server)上部署时,需要考虑处理器架构的兼容性,特别是对AVX-512指令集的支持程度。以Gaussian、ORCA等主流量子化学软件为例,其计算效率与CPU的浮点运算能力直接相关。内存带宽同样是关键指标,建议选择配备DDR4 3200MHz以上内存的VPS实例。存储方面,NVMe SSD能显著改善大型波函数文件的读写速度,这对含过渡态搜索(TS Search)的计算尤为重要。网络延迟虽然不影响单点计算,但在分布式计算场景下,建议选择具备10Gbps以上内网带宽的VPS集群。

美国VPS服务商性能对比与选择

美国作为全球云计算基础设施最发达的地区,提供VPS服务的厂商超过百家。针对量子化学计算场景,我们重点测试了AWS EC2 c5.4xlarge实例、Google Cloud n2-standard-16以及Linode Dedicated CPU方案。测试数据显示,在运行DFT(密度泛函理论)计算时,AWS凭借定制的Intel Xeon Platinum处理器,单节点性能领先15%。但Google Cloud的持续性折扣政策使其在长期计算任务中更具成本优势。值得注意的是,部分厂商如Vultr提供裸金属服务器,虽然价格较高,但避免了虚拟化层(Hypervisor)的性能损耗,特别适合需要精确计时(Timing Critical)的耦合簇(CCSD(T))计算。如何选择?关键要看计算任务的并行化程度和预算限制。

量子化学软件栈的编译与优化

在VPS环境部署量子化学软件时,源码编译往往比直接安装二进制包获得更好性能。以NWChem为例,编译时应启用ARMCI(Aggregate Remote Memory Copy Interface)库以优化进程间通信。对于GAMESS软件,建议修改Makefile中的OPTFLAG参数,添加-march=native编译选项以充分利用CPU指令集。内存分配策略也需特别注意,当VPS配备大容量内存时,可调整libnuma的NUMA(Non-Uniform Memory Access)策略为interleave模式,避免内存访问热点。测试表明,经过深度优化的ORCA软件在VPS上运行MP2计算时,速度可比默认配置提升22%。别忘了设置正确的BLAS/LAPACK库路径,Intel MKL在Xeon处理器上的表现通常优于OpenBLAS。

并行计算环境的配置技巧

量子化学计算的并行效率直接影响VPS资源利用率。需要正确配置MPI(Message Passing Interface)环境,OpenMPI 4.0+版本对RDMA(远程直接内存访问)的支持能显著降低多节点计算的通信开销。在Slurm作业调度系统中,应设置--cpu-bind=cores参数保证线程亲和性。有趣的是,我们的测试发现,对于HF(Hartree-Fock)计算,使用混合并行模式(MPI+OpenMP)时,每个物理核分配1-2个MPI进程配合2-4个OpenMP线程,往往比纯MPI模式快18%。对于DFT计算,则建议采用纯MPI模式并启用线性代数加速库。特别提醒:美国东西海岸VPS间的网络延迟可能高达70ms,跨区域MPI集群需谨慎评估。

计算任务监控与故障处理

长时间运行的量子化学计算需要完善的监控机制。通过Prometheus+Grafana搭建的监控系统可以实时跟踪VPS的CPU利用率、内存压力和磁盘I/O。当进行CASSCF(完全活性空间自洽场)等内存密集型计算时,应设置cgroup内存限制防止OOM(Out Of Memory) killer终止关键进程。对于常见的SCF不收敛问题,可通过修改guess=read关键字重用初始轨道。网络闪断导致的MPI作业中断是个棘手问题,建议使用ULFM(User Level Failure Mitigation)扩展的MPICH版本,它能在节点失效时自动恢复计算。日志分析方面,将Gaussian的%rwf文件定期备份到持久化存储,能有效避免计算中断时的数据丢失。

通过本文介绍的美国VPS量子化学计算配置方案,研究人员可以构建媲美本地集群的计算环境。从硬件选型到软件优化,从并行配置到故障处理,每个环节都直接影响最终的计算效率。随着云计算技术的进步,未来在VPS上运行高精度量子化学计算(如MRCI多参考组态相互作用)将变得更加可行,为计算化学研究开辟新的可能性。

版权声明

    声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们996811936@qq.com进行处理。